Admission Process Overview

The admission process for the B.Tech Electrical Engineering program at Maulana Azad University Jodhpur follows a structured framework based on merit and availability of seats. Candidates must fulfill specific eligibility criteria and complete several steps to secure admission.

The primary mode of admission is through the Joint Entrance Examination (JEE) Advanced conducted by the Indian Institutes of Technology (IITs). Alternatively, candidates may qualify through JEE Main followed by state-level counseling processes if they meet the required qualifications. The university also considers scores from other recognized entrance exams such as BITSAT, VITEEE, and MHT-CET depending on the category of applicants.

Step-by-Step Admission Procedure

The admission procedure begins with online registration on the official website of the university. Candidates must fill out the application form with accurate personal details, educational qualifications, and preferences for branches and categories. The application fee is non-refundable and varies based on gender and category.

After submitting the application, candidates receive a unique application number which serves as proof of submission. They are then required to upload scanned copies of documents including photograph, signature, and educational certificates. Verification of these documents is carried out at the time of counseling or admission.

Once the application is processed, candidates appear for the qualifying examination such as JEE Advanced or JEE Main. Based on performance in these exams, merit lists are prepared for each category and branch allocation takes place accordingly.

Candidates who qualify are called for counseling sessions where they choose their preferred institutions and branches based on their ranks and available seats. The final seat acceptance is confirmed upon payment of the required fees and submission of original documents.

Exam Preparation Strategy

Preparing for JEE Advanced requires strategic planning, consistent effort, and focused study techniques. Candidates should begin by thoroughly understanding the syllabus and exam pattern. A structured timetable that allocates time for each subject helps in maintaining balance between theory and practice.

Regular practice through mock tests and previous years' question papers enhances problem-solving skills and builds confidence. Solving numerical problems from standard textbooks like NCERT, H.C. Verma, and R.D. Sharma is recommended. Additionally, joining coaching classes or online platforms for guidance can be beneficial.

It is crucial to stay updated with current affairs, especially in the Physics section where topics like nuclear physics and thermodynamics are often linked to real-world applications. Time management during exams is equally important; candidates should practice answering questions within stipulated time limits.

Counseling Advice

During counseling, selecting appropriate institutions and branches requires careful consideration of one's rank, category, and preferences. Candidates should research the reputation, placement record, and infrastructure of various universities before making choices.

It is advisable to prioritize top-tier colleges with strong programs in Electrical Engineering. However, it is equally important to consider proximity to home, accommodation facilities, and cost implications. Filling choices wisely can increase chances of securing admission to preferred institutions.

For better understanding of the seat allocation process, candidates should familiarize themselves with the concept of opening and closing ranks for each category and branch. These figures help in predicting the likelihood of getting admission in a particular college.

The final step involves confirming the chosen seat by paying the required fees and submitting necessary documents. Candidates must ensure that all details are correct before finalizing their selection to avoid any complications later on.
